How is Chinese jellyfish prepared?

Dehydrated and pickled jellyfish is considered a delicacy in several Asian countries, including China, Korea, Taiwan, Vietnam, and Japan. Dehydrated jellyfish can be prepared for eating by soaking it in water for several hours to rehydrate it, and then parboiling, rinsing and slicing it.

Can you eat a jellyfish?

You can eat jellyfish in many ways, including shredded or sliced thinly and tossed with sugar, soy sauce, oil, and vinegar for a salad. It can also be cut into noodles, boiled, and served mixed with vegetables or meat. Prepared jellyfish has a delicate flavor and surprisingly crunchy texture.

How do you cook instant jellyfish?

DIRECTIONS

  1. To prep jellyfish:
  2. Rinse very well in cold water and drain.
  3. Mix soy sauce, sesame oil, vinegar, and sugar in a small bowl.
  4. Let sit 30 minutes.
  5. Just before serving, garnish with sesame seeds.
  6. You may heat this recipe if you like; just stir fry it in a wok about 3 minutes, but it is best served cold.

What’s best for jellyfish stings?

What If You Get Stung By a Jellyfish?

  • Rinse the area with vinegar. (Not cool fresh water or seawater, which could make it worse.)
  • Avoid rubbing the area, which also can make things worse.
  • Use tweezers to pull off any tentacles still on your skin.
  • Do not put ice or ice packs on a sting.
  • Check with your doctor.

Are jellyfish crunchy?

Jellyfish have long been part of Asian diets, often eaten salted and dried. The taste and texture is similar to that of cartilage: crunchy, with the jellyfish absorbing whatever flavor is put in the marinade.

Who eats jellyfish?

Sea anemones may eat jellyfish that drift into their range. Other predators include tunas, sharks, swordfish, sea turtles and penguins. Jellyfish washed up on the beach are consumed by foxes, other terrestrial mammals and birds.
